Lantheus is Hiring a Senior Project Manager (Infrastructure / Capital Planning) Near Billerica, MA

Description

Summary

In this position, the ideal candidate will work independently to lead cross-functional project teams through all phases of Infrastructure-Utility, Lab-Office and GMP Manufacturing projects-from scope development, design, CQV and close-out. This position will consistently deliver projects that meet all stakeholder requirements and are fully commissioned, qualified and ready for start-up / occupancy.

Key Responsibilities / Essential Functions

  • Use LMI project planning tools and management principles to initiate, design, develop, and evaluate plans for assigned projects and hold projects on budget and schedule coordinating parallel activities.
  • Lead team members during project execution including Manufacturing staff, Facilities staff, multiple outside vendors and contractors. Project Management responsibility for projects in the $500K- $10M range.
  • Drive alignment on scope and project status through transparent, timely, and clear verbal and written communications to teams, stakeholders and appropriate levels of the organization of both technical and non-technical topics.
  • Partner with Purchasing to prepare bid packages for design and construction contracts; effectively lead the negotiation, award and management of contracts and agreements with AE firms, vendors, construction contractors, regulatory and government agencies.
  • Prepare project estimates for design, equipment, installation, labor, materials, and other related costs.
  • Develop, manage and maintain up-to-date MS Project schedules inclusive of all critical milestones, key interdependencies and resource constraints, applying appropriate project scheduling techniques.
  • Utilizing MS Project schedules and project estimates, develop cash flows and track project spend on monthly basis, preparing monthly reports to inform management on project progress.
  • Drive the execution of external design partners and construction firms to deliver the right scope at the right time. Set clear expectations across all phases of partner onboarding including: Scope/RFP generation, bid reviews, contract execution, and contractor onboarding. Approve, manage, coordinate and oversee development of project design documents. Select A/E firms to perform engineering design. Coordinate and lead team review of designs/deliverables and document decisions accordingly.
  • Manage and oversee project contract work both in engineering and construction. Inspect or direct the inspection of work to ensure conformance to design drawings, specifications, schedules, and safety regulations. Ensure contractors receive site orientation and training and that all state/local code requirements, building permits, inspection and project close-out processes are followed.
  • Establish clear performance and acceptance criteria, draft and execute project commissioning plans and ensure that projects and equipment are rigorously designed and tested to this criteria. Drive effective project turnover from the engineering function into the business owners.
  • Achieve effective financial control through management of project scope, estimating, risk management, and project closeout. Negotiate with contractors and suppliers to keep projects within budget while obtaining excellent value. Manage the review and approval of contractor RFI's, submittals, and change requests.
  • Provide project management reports and presentations. Monitor project status and execution.
  • Incorporate safety into all aspects of projects; construction safety management, site security, environmental control, hazardous materials management, fire protection and life safety systems.
  • Utilize effective meeting management principles to drive results oriented project meetings including development of clear agendas, capturing and timely distribution of minutes, & proactive follow-up of assigned tasks.

Basic Qualifications

  • 4 year BS degree in engineering is required. Advanced degree in industry relevant discipline or MBA is a plus.
  • Minimum of 10 years demonstrated Project Engineering & Management experience leading cross-functional project teams for design, construction, commissioning & qualification, and start-up with a proven track record of on-time & on-budget performance for complex projects related to Pharmaceutical Manufacturing Facilities.
  • Strong technical skills in pharmaceutical equipment, utilities systems, and facilities engineering preferred. Basic understanding of building and equipment automation capabilities and industry best practices.
  • Demonstrated working knowledge of MS Office suite of software tools (PowerPoint, Excel, Word), as well as, demonstrated competency in the use of MS Project.
  • Strong knowledge of engineering standards and all applicable regulatory requirements including: Building Codes, Factory Mutual, Environmental, GMP/GLP, OSHA and ADA.
  • Strong understanding of Quality Systems. Solid understanding of cGMPs. Able to interpret CFRs in establishing current practices.
  • Demonstrated skills in basic technical report writing: Engineering studies, user requirement specifications, commissioning documents.
  • Excellent leadership, interpersonal, influencing, organizational and time management skills.
  • Excellent oral & written communication skills.
  • Demonstrated sound judgment, good business acumen and strong analytical skills.
  • Ability and willingness to accommodate flexible scheduling including off-hours and week-end work.
  • Travel 5-10 percent.

Other Requirements

  • This individual should be a self-starter with strong leadership, interpersonal, organizational and technical skills, with the capability to work both independently and in a team environment. Strong analytical and communications skills are critical.
  • Project Management education, training, and/or PMP certification is desirable.
  • Affiliations with relevant industry associations, such as ISPE, PDA, etc.
  • Knowledge of and experience with lean concepts and tools.
